
In June 1993, Champaka published a beautiful screen-print, “Vacances fatales”, by Vittorio Giardino, creator of “Sam Pezzo” and “Max Fridman.” It featured a young woman in an idyllic setting, one that was enticing and carefree. The woman was seated at a small wooden table, on a terrace. On the table were some grapes and a glass of wine. Behind her, one could see an outdoor shower, some cactus plants and a spectacular view of the Mediterranean seascape, dotted with small islands. Ten years further on, we meet again the same beautiful reader, this time in “Nuit d’été.” By some strange miracle, she is untouched by the passage of time…
